mirror of
https://github.com/apple/pkl.git
synced 2026-01-11 14:20:35 +01:00
[PR #1024] [MERGED] move parser out of pkl-core #859
Reference in New Issue
Block a user
Delete Branch "%!s()"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
📋 Pull Request Information
Original PR: https://github.com/apple/pkl/pull/1024
Author: @stackoverflow
Created: 3/14/2025
Status: ✅ Merged
Merged: 3/18/2025
Merged by: @stackoverflow
Base:
main← Head:parser-module📝 Commits (4)
0c16fedmove parser out of pkl-core72905d2fix pkl-parser configuration6fea2b7fix review remarks28371bfremove generator📊 Changes
80 files changed (+906 additions, -739 deletions)
View changed files
📝
build.gradle.kts(+2 -2)📝
docs/docs.gradle.kts(+2 -1)📝
docs/src/test/kotlin/DocSnippetTests.kt(+4 -4)📝
pkl-core/gradle.lockfile(+0 -6)📝
pkl-core/pkl-core.gradle.kts(+2 -51)📝
pkl-core/src/main/java/org/pkl/core/PcfRenderer.java(+1 -1)📝
pkl-core/src/main/java/org/pkl/core/ast/builder/AbstractAstBuilder.java(+6 -6)📝
pkl-core/src/main/java/org/pkl/core/ast/builder/AstBuilder.java(+79 -79)📝
pkl-core/src/main/java/org/pkl/core/ast/builder/ImportsAndReadsParser.java(+11 -11)📝
pkl-core/src/main/java/org/pkl/core/ast/builder/SymbolTable.java(+1 -1)➖
pkl-core/src/main/java/org/pkl/core/parser/package-info.java(+0 -4)➖
pkl-core/src/main/java/org/pkl/core/parser/syntax/package-info.java(+0 -4)📝
pkl-core/src/main/java/org/pkl/core/repl/ReplServer.java(+10 -10)📝
pkl-core/src/main/java/org/pkl/core/runtime/MinPklVersionChecker.java(+4 -4)📝
pkl-core/src/main/java/org/pkl/core/runtime/VmLanguage.java(+3 -3)📝
pkl-core/src/main/java/org/pkl/core/runtime/VmUndefinedValueException.java(+1 -1)📝
pkl-core/src/main/java/org/pkl/core/runtime/VmUtils.java(+3 -3)📝
pkl-core/src/main/java/org/pkl/core/runtime/VmValueRenderer.java(+1 -1)📝
pkl-core/src/main/java/org/pkl/core/stdlib/base/PcfRenderer.java(+1 -1)📝
pkl-core/src/main/resources/org/pkl/core/errorMessages.properties(+0 -125)...and 60 more files
📄 Description
No description provided
🔄 This issue represents a GitHub Pull Request. It cannot be merged through Gitea due to API limitations.